Process Capability Analysis tells us how well a process meets a set of specification limits, based on a sample of data taken from a process. On the mathematical side we require the process to follow a normal distribution so we can take advantage of the properties there. The process mean (average) and standard deviation are calculated. In equation for Pp and Ppk we use standard deviation based on studied data (whole population), and in equation for calculation Cp and Cpk we use sample deviation or deviation mean within rational subgroups. With a normal distribution, the "tails" can extend well beyond plus and minus three standard deviations, but this interval should contain about 99.73% of production output.
